reCAPTCHA WAF Session Token
Software Engineering

Master Software Engineering: A Comprehensive Guide to Understanding the Course

Master Software Engineering: A Comprehensive Guide to Understanding the Course

Software engineering is a rapidly growing field that plays a crucial role in developing and maintaining software systems. As technology continues to advance, the need for skilled software engineers is only increasing. If you are interested in pursuing a career in software engineering, obtaining a Master’s degree in Software Engineering is a great way to enhance your skills and knowledge in this field.

What is Master Software Engineering?

A Master’s degree in Software Engineering is a graduate-level program that focuses on the principles, practices, and methodologies of software development. This program is designed to provide students with the advanced technical and analytical skills needed to design, develop, and maintain software systems. The curriculum typically covers a wide range of topics, including software architecture, requirements engineering, software testing, project management, and software maintenance.

Why pursue a Master’s degree in Software Engineering?

There are several reasons why pursuing a Master’s degree in Software Engineering can be beneficial for your career. First and foremost, this program will provide you with a deep understanding of software engineering principles and practices, which will make you a more competitive candidate in the job market. Additionally, earning a Master’s degree can open up new career opportunities and increase your earning potential.

What can you expect from a Master’s degree in Software Engineering?

A Master’s degree in Software Engineering typically requires two years of full-time study, although some programs may offer part-time or online options. The curriculum is usually a mix of coursework, research, and practical experience, with an emphasis on real-world applications. Students will have the opportunity to work on projects that simulate industry scenarios, allowing them to develop their skills and build a portfolio of work.

Some of the courses you can expect to take in a Master’s program in Software Engineering include:

– Software Architecture and Design

– Software Requirements Engineering

– Software Testing and Quality Assurance

– Software Project Management

– Software Maintenance and Evolution

– Advanced Topics in Software Engineering

In addition to coursework, students may also have the opportunity to complete a thesis or capstone project, where they can apply their knowledge and skills to solve a real-world software engineering problem.

Is a Master’s degree in Software Engineering right for you?

If you have a passion for technology and a knack for problem-solving, a Master’s degree in Software Engineering could be the perfect fit for you. This program is ideal for individuals who have a background in computer science, engineering, or a related field, and who are looking to advance their career in software development.

Overall, a Master’s degree in Software Engineering is a valuable investment in your future that can open up a world of opportunities in the fast-paced and ever-evolving field of software engineering. By honing your skills and knowledge in this area, you will be well-equipped to tackle the challenges of designing and developing software systems in today’s digital world.

Leave a Reply

Your email address will not be published. Required fields are marked *

Back to top button
WP Twitter Auto Publish Powered By : XYZScripts.com
SiteLock